Home > Term: placeholder
placeholder
(1) The symbol, consisting of a single period in a REXX parsing template, that can be replaced by a value while running a REXX program. A placeholder has the same effect as a variable name, except that no variable is set.
(2) An object, component or file that only exists to mark the position of an intended entity.
(3) A variable that is replaced with a value.
